Overview

Southend-on-Sea City Council is seeking a supplier to supply, install and maintain intelligent transport systems across the city, including traffic signals, variable message signs, car park guidance signs and vehicle speed activated signs. The supplier will monitor and repair equipment via the Council's asset management system on a daily basis, perform annual inspections and cleaning, and supply and install new equipment as funding becomes available throughout the contract term, with an estimated value of £3 million.
